I've got two SF Vibrochamps, Both of which call for a 3.2ohm speaker. Now Theres a bunch of companys that make 8" (and 10" for the modded VC) speakers I wouldn't mind trying out, But hardly anyone seems to make 3.2Ohm speakers. Finding 4ohm speakers is much easier though.

So my question is, Would putting a 4ohm speaker into an amp that calls for a 3.2Ohm speaker be a bad idea? It doesn't seem like to much of a miss match ( 0.8 ohms) but, being as I really don't know to much about this, I figured I better ask. Also I know that the champs tended to not have as sturdy trannys as most other amps, so that might make some difference too?

4 ohms will work just fine. Contact Ted Weber at Weber VST. He makes the best sounding 8" and 10" speakers around, IMO.
